Regarding the latest of its community theatre productions ,Teatro Experimental Yerbabruja just completed a 4-year "run" of its original social theatre play
What Killed Marcelo Lucero?
"...succeeds where so many speeches and editorials fail. It points, at least, to where deeper understanding might lie and how people might get there together."
- NEW YORK TIMES
"...opens a window into the lives of immigrants living underground on Long Island."
- NEWSDAY
The next such original play, dealing with multi-cultural women's issues, is currently in development.
Our Mission -
To advance cultural understanding, within the diverse Long Island communities that we serve, by using the theatrical and other performing and visual arts as tools to promote constructive social change; and to provide opportunities for emerging and established artists.
